Tracking the Oxygen Readings during
Calibration and Alarm delay
The user has the option of setting the preference as to whether the
analog outputs track the display readings during calibration or not. To
set the preference, press the System key once and the first System menu
will appear in the VFD display:
TRAK/HLD Auto-Cal
PSWD Logout More
TRAK/HLD
should be blinking. To enter this system menu press the
Enter key once:
Output Sttng: TRACK
Alarm Dly: 10 min
—or—
Output Sttng: HOLD
Alarm Dly: 10 min
In the first line,
TRACK
or
HOLD
should be blinking. The operator
can toggle between
TRACK
and
HOLD
with the Up or Down keys. When
TRACK
is selected, the analog outputs (0-1 VDC and 4-20 ma) and the
range ID contacts will track the instrument readings during calibration
(either zero or span).
TRACK
is the factory default.
When
HOLD
is selected, the analog outputs (0-1 VDC and 4-20 ma)
and the range ID contacts will freeze on their last state before entering
one of the calibration modes. When the instrument returns to the
Analyze mode, either by a successful or an aborted calibration, there
will be a three-minute delay before the analog outputs and the range ID
contacts start tracking again.
The concentration alarms freeze on their last state before entering
calibration regardless of selecting
HOLD
or
TRACK
. But, when
HOLD
is
selected the concentration alarms will remain frozen for the time
displayed in the second line of the
TRAK/HLD
menu after the analyzer
returns to the Analyze mode.
